NCA9595-Q100
description
The NCA9595-Q100 provides 16 bits of General Purpose Input/Output (GPIO) expansion for I²Cbus/SMBus applications. It is designed for a wide voltage range of 1.65 V to 5.5 V with interrupt and default pull-up resistors on GPIOs. Nexperia GPIO expanders provide an elegant solution when additional IOs are needed while keeping the interconnections to a minimum, for example, in ACPI power switches, sensors, push buttons, LEDs and fan control. The NCA9595-Q100 contains a set of 8 bit input, output, configuration, polarity inversion and configuration pull-up registers. At power up all IOs default to inputs. Each IO can be configured as either input or output by changing the corresponding bit in the configuration register. The data for each input or output is stored in the corresponding input or output register. The polarity inversion register can be programmed to invert the polarity of the input register. The pull-up resistors can be disconnected by programming configuration pull...